So, you've got this character, Alice. Seems like a nice enough person, interacts pleasantly with the heroes, maybe offers them some help or advice. And then the heroes leave the room, or just turn their backs. The camera however, hangs around watching Alice for a few seconds. And sure enough, as soon as no one's watching, Alice starts looking shifty, or even downright evil. This is the Traitor Shot, a close-up on a character for no apparent reason, which is practically a guarantee that at some point, that person will betray the heroes in some way.
